| 1 | | HOUSE RESOLUTION
|
| 2 | | WHEREAS, Computer Science Education is important in |
| 3 | | today's modern, digital society; and
|
| 4 | | WHEREAS, The computer science field is one of the |
| 5 | | fastest-growing and highest-paying career paths in the world; |
| 6 | | and
|
| 7 | | WHEREAS, Educating students in computer science is |
| 8 | | beneficial to all students, not just those interested in the |
| 9 | | computer science field; students must be proficient in using |
| 10 | | computers, whether it be to create a file, write a report, or |
| 11 | | research a certain subject, regardless of their field of |
| 12 | | interest; and
|
| 13 | | WHEREAS, With the digital age rising, there is a need to |
| 14 | | develop logical thinking and problem-solving skills, which are |
| 15 | | all part of the computer science curriculum; and
|
| 16 | | WHEREAS, Job openings requiring computer science skills |
| 17 | | are growing in every industry and in every state and are |
| 18 | | projected to grow at twice the rate of any other job; and
